ABSTRACT:
A disc cartridge capable of holding a disc in a casing in a state of floating in a space in the casting to keep it in noncontact with the casing when the disc cartridge is not used. The disc cartridge includes an actuator arranged in a casing receiving a disc therein to releasable lock a shutter for a window and a disc receiver arranged in the casing and operatively connected to the actuator to selectively receive therein a part of a peripheral portion of the disc. The actuator is arranged to be slidable in a longitudinal direction of the disc cartridge to cause the disc receiver to be approachably moved with respect to the disc, so that the disc receiver may be engaged with the disc to rearwardly force the disc while keeping the disc in noncontact with the casing when the shutter is actuated to close the window and disengaged from the disc when the shutter is actuated to open the window.
